I thought this would be quite obvious.

The first is 343 Guilty Spark betraying Master Chief. This is because 343GS didn't tell MC the whole story about Halo. MC thought that Halo had defences like guns against the flood, not the fact that the defence is to take out their food (killing all sentient life in the galaxy). 343GS starts to fire upon MC.

The second is MC Betraying GS343. MC says he will help 343GS take out the flood (whole reason of 'The Library'), but changes his mind once he finds out 343GS plans.

The fact is that there was Two Betrayals is because they both wanted the same thing, but one didn't tell the whole truth to the other and they turned on each other.

Come on, MC aint gunna stand there and do nothing while 343GS begins to lay into him. He's gunna retrurn fire.

I've come to the conclusion that it the title 'Two Betrayals' could have numerous meanings. Obviously about two separate cases of betrayal, but the culprit of this could be many.

These seem to be the main that I think of:
* Guilty Spark betraying MC (not giving full truth on the purpose of the installation).
* MC betraying Guilty Spark (because GS double-crosses him, and set sentinals at MC).
* Cortana betraying MC (not telling the whole truth about the flood to MC when she could have done easily. "We've got to stop the Captain!....Go Stop Keyes!")
